Varieties of Packaging Materials to Keep Your Treats Fresh

With respect to keeping the freshness of bakery products, the use of packaging materials makes a significant difference. Plastic containers deliver secure seals that lock in moisture, while numerous paper wrapping choices ensure airflow and a traditional appearance. Grasping the merits of each packaging choice allows bakers to determine the best approach for the best possible preservation.

Plastic Containers Benefits

Plastic containers present a convenient choice for keeping the freshness of bakery products. Their airtight seals effectively protect against moisture and air exposure, which can lead to spoilage. Both durable and lightweight, plastic containers are simple to carry and maneuver, making them well-suited to both home bakers and commercial operations. They can be found in various shapes and sizes, accommodating everything from cookies to cakes. Additionally, numerous plastic containers are clear, permitting attractive showcasing while enabling customers to view the contents easily. Reusability is another significant benefit, as they are easily cleaned and used again. In addition, plastic containers are generally affordable, making them suitable for budget-conscious bakers while guaranteeing that goods stay fresh and attractive.

Paper Packaging Choices

Several paper packaging related article choices deliver efficient solutions for maintaining the condition of baked treats. Grease-resistant paper is commonly chosen for its power to resist grease and liquids, sustaining the quality of items like pastries and cookies. Waxed paper presents like qualities, establishing a shield against humidity and exposure, while also delivering a classic aesthetic. For larger items, paper bags featuring a window permit visibility while securing contents from the surrounding environment. Additionally, sturdy kraft paper containers are robust and environmentally friendly, making them a sustainable solution for pies and cupcakes. Every choice not only ensures freshness but also boosts aesthetics, inviting customers to savor the items inside. At the end of the day, choosing the appropriate paper packaging can improve both visual appeal and freshness.

How to Pick the Right Box for Your Treats

Choosing the perfect container for baked goods demands close examination of a few important factors. Initially, the measurements of the box should align with the number and kind of items being stored. A tight fit reduces shifting, which can cause harm. Next, the choice of material is crucial; strong materials like cardboard or plastic offer protection while keeping items fresh.

The box's overall design is equally important, as it ought to enhance the visual appeal of the items inside. See-through panels can highlight beautifully crafted items, while vibrant colors can attract attention. Additionally, consider the box's convenience of assembly and transport; uncomplicated designs support faster packing and handling.

Lastly, verify the box is safe for food use, as safety is paramount in the packaging of food. By balancing design, size, material, and functionality, bakers can choose the most suitable box that protects their creations while presenting them beautifully.

Frequently Asked Questions

How Do I Properly Store Baked Goods Before Packaging?

To adequately store baked goods before they are packaged, one ought to allow them to cool entirely on a wire rack, before placing them in sealed containers or wrap them tightly in cling wrap to maintain freshness and minimize moisture loss.

Can Store-Bought Baked Goods Packaging Be Reused?

Absolutely, people can make use of packaging sourced from commercially purchased baked goods, so long as it is in clean and intact condition. That said, adequate sanitation is crucial to prevent contamination and maintain the freshness of the new baked items.

Which Packaging Size Works Best for Various Baked Goods?

Optimal packaging sizes differ: small boxes are perfect for cookies, mid-sized containers are suitable for cupcakes, while bigger boxes are designed for cakes. Ensuring snug fits prevents damage and maintains freshness, improving the overall appearance of every baked item.

What Steps Can I Take to Make Sure My Packaging Is Food-Safe?

To guarantee food-safe packaging, one must select materials approved by regulatory agencies, steer clear of hazardous chemicals, and confirm that all containers are free from harmful substances. Additionally, maintaining appropriate sealing methods and hygiene standards during handling significantly improves overall safety.
